For today’s blog hop, I used the Craft-A-Flower Clematis Layering Die Set to create some simple yet beautifully realistic flowers.

CAF Clematis

I used white crepe paper to die-cut the petals, gluing two sheets together first to make them a little thicker. For the centres and leaves, I used standard white cardstock. I then added colour using Olive and Moss Fresh Dye Inks with the Mini Blending Brush Set. My final step was to assemble all the layers and shape the flowers by gently pulling in the direction of the crepe paper grain.

CAF Clematis

These beautiful crepe paper flowers are incredibly versatile! You can use them for cards, mixed media projects, home or party décor. I chose to use one to top a wrapped present, adding a personal and special touch.

CAF Clematis

For my wrapping paper, I used plain white paper and a linear pattern stencil from the Stencil Art: Styled Backgrounds Layering Stencil Set (6-in-1), applying Olive Fresh Dye Ink to create a subtle yet playful background. I also added a tag made with the Creative Labels Bundle for a finishing touch.
